The area of the Municipality of Višnjan is situated in the inland part of the Western Istria and covers a 20 km wide belt.
The surface area of the Municipality is 65.42 km2, and it consists of 54 villages and settlements.
The Municipality of Višnjan spreads graphically over the area at an altitude of 250 m above sea level, with slightly elevated terrains, facing the sea, and thus suitable for the cultivation of vines, olives and cereals, which are, at the same time, the main cultures growing on the Municipality fields.
Average annual temperature is 13.4°C. Winds are a frequent occurence in these parts, the most frequent being bura, jugo, maestral and levante. In accordance with climatic conditions, precipitation, amount of sun, winds and soil composition, the population of the Municipality of Višnjan are mainly engaged in agriculture and animal rearing, which, at the same time, forms the economic base of this area. The Municipality of Višnjan has 2,187 inhabitants (according to the 2001 census) with 737 households, including 4 cadastral municipalities. According to the same census, the Municipality of Višnjan has 1,079 male and 1,108 female inhabitants, of which 531 male and 338 female are work able persons.
